B Barrick Mining Earnings and EPS analysis

?
Relative Growth: Rel. Growth: 92
Relative Strength: Rel. Strength: 91
Relative Valuation: Rel. Valuation: 77
Relative Profitability: Rel. Profitability: 87

EPS in 2025 (TTM): $1.59

Last Report Period Date: Jun 30, 2025

As of November 2025, according to Barrick Mining's current financial statements, the company's 12-month EPS is $1.59. For the year 2024, the company recorded an earnings per share (EPS) of $1.22, which marks an increase compared to its EPS of $0.72 in 2023. Barrick Mining's earnings per share for the quarterly report ending on Jun 30, 2025 reached $0.47.

B earnings history

Historical annual and quarterly earnings per share (EPS) data for Barrick Mining
EPS (TTM)
$1.59
EPS Growth YoY (Quarterly)
123.8%
EPS (Quarterly)
$0.47
EPS Growth (Quarterly)
74.1%

The annual EPS for the year 2024 was $1.22, an increase of 69.4% from $0.72 in 2023. For the fiscal quarter that ended on Jun 30, 2025, the per-share earnings was $0.47, showing a 123.8% increase from the same quarter last year. For the twelve months ending June 2025, the EPS is $1.59. For the year 2023, the yearly earnings per share was $0.72, marking an increase of 200% from 2022.

B EPS growth

Earnings per share growth rates over time
EPS Growth YoY (Quarterly)
123.8%
EPS growth YoY
69.4%
EPS growth 3Y avg
2.3%
EPS growth 5Y avg
-11.6%

Barrick Mining has registered an increase in EPS of 123.8% during the last 12 months (YoY, quarterly). Throughout the last three years, the company had an average EPS growth of 2.3% per year. Barrick Mining had an average annual EPS growth rate of -11.6% during the last 5 years.

B Earnings Waterfall

Breakdown of revenue, profit and net income for Barrick Mining

B Earnings vs Peers

What are the earnings of B compared to its peers
Stock name Price to Earnings EPS grwoth 1Y EPS grwoth 3Y EPS grwoth 5Y
NEM NEWMONT Corp 12.68 198.3% 26% -5.2%
EGO Eldorado Gold Corp. 14.55 163% N/A 22.7%
B Barrick Mining Corp. 20.62 69.4% 2.3% -11.6%
AGI Alamos Gold Inc. 24.02 32.1% N/A 22.9%

All data is based on quarterly TTM periods, unless otherwise specified.